Must Ask Contest Entry Questions
- What is your full name and preferred contact information (email and phone)?
You need this to verify identity and reach winners fast. Clear contact details prevent missed notifications and reduce redraws.
- Which category (and age group, if applicable) are you entering?
Category routing lets you compare like with like and assign the right judges. For example, the Logo design competition form uses categories to keep judging fair.
- Do you meet the eligibility requirements and agree to the official rules?
An explicit yes prevents ineligible entries and protects your team legally. It also speeds screening, since you can filter entries that accepted the rules.
- Please upload your entry and provide a short description (100-150 words).
A file plus context helps judges understand your intent and criteria fit. The summary also makes it easier to showcase finalists on your site or social channels.
- How did you hear about this contest, and may we email you about future events?
Source data shows which channels drive quality entries, so you can invest in what works. If you seek opt-ins, model your consent language on a promotion-focused flow like the Promotion entry form.
